INDIA. Kushan Empire. Huvishka (ca. AD 151-190). AV dinar (19mm, 7.84 gm, 12h). NGC Choice XF 5/5 - 4/5, edge marks. Kushan standard, Bactria, main mint (probably Balkh), early phase. ÞAONANOÞAO O-OHÞKI KOÞANO, half-length bust of Huvishka left, on mountain top (off flan), wearing mustache, heavy sideburns, and prominent wart on cheek, round helmet with crest ornament, twin-pronged forehead ornament, crescent on side, and a jeweled rim, diadem with triangular tie and double ladder-like ribbons to right, and loose-fitting tunic with jeweled collar, flames emanating from right shoulder, club in right hand with extended index finger, sword hilt in left / ΦAPPO, Pharro standing facing, turned right, nimbate head right, wearing helmet with forehead ornament, diadem with triangular tie and two ribbons to left, cloak around shoulders double-clasped at chest over calf-length tunic, and boots, grounded staff with knob finial in left hand, bag of coins in right palm at waist; tamgha with crossbar in right field, dotted border. ANS Kushan 714. Sunrise -. Mitchiner -. Göbl, MK 141/7.

At present, NGC does not grade Kushan, Kidarite, Gupta, Kaivartas, or Samatata gold coins. However, as a special, one-time consideration, NGC Ancients has encapsulated these selections from the extensive Historical Scholar Collection.
